I can't feel anything, see anything. Everything is dark. Where am I? Better yet, who am I?
My eyes slowly open to a dimly lit room. It is what appears to be a throne room, but I am sprawled across the floor. I sit up and grasp my middle in pain. "It burns," I flinch, glad that there's no blood at least. Still, the question remains: what in the literal fuck is happening?
"You can stand. I'm sure you're fine now, Dan," I turn quickly to find no one in sight.
"Show yourself immediately," I try to come off stern, but my voice pitches and I'm left feelings more embarrassed and vulnerable than I did in the first place.
From behind one of the pillars, a young girl walks out. She chuckles sweetly. A voice so soft and sweet. Hair of pure white that drapes down her shoulders to her waist. She seems that of an angel. A white dress reaches just above her knees and a working clock pendant dangles from around her neck. But, she wears an white bandage over her right eye. And her left eye… it's so dark. I can't even see her pupils; they're a black i've never seen before, never knew existed.
She bows before me. "Yes?"
"Uh, hello… weird question, but do you know where we are?" She looks innocent at no age older than nine.
"We are in Upper Folsense. In the castle, precisely." I can't help but notice as sweet as her voice is, it's so monotone. I wonder who she is, but figure I should probably find out who I am first.
"Right… another weird question, but do you know me? I think I lost my memory and everything is really, really confusing." There is silence for a while. It seems to echo off the marble, checkered floor around me and to the grand pillars to the sides of us. It is so dim and dusty; I feel as if I'm in more of a museum than I am a castle.
"Your name is Dan. I can't tell you the rest, but please, remember not to leave the castle. It is vital that you don't. Do you understand?" Her eyes seem to be pleading and I scoot back a bit.
"Why is that? Is someone trying to kill me?"
"Please, stay in the shadows, Dan. Just wait things out. That's all you can do for now," The heels of her bare feet tap the marble as she starts for the door.
"Wait-! Why can't I leave! What am I waiting for? What's your name!"
She stops at the door and shakes her head. "It's not important. Thank you, though." And she's gone.
The room sings a song of blandness as I sit alone. There's no way I can't leave this castle. Does she really expect me not to want to find out more about myself? I've gotta get out of here… I've gotta talk to someone and get some information.
I grip my stomach as I start for the door the girl recently exited, but found it locked. "Hello! Anyone! Let me out!" I pound against the door, until later sliding down in defeat.
Just what, or who, am I waiting for?
